Scope
ESDU 72012 gives general information on the data in the Structures Series on quadrilateral plates and panels subjected to in-plane compression. It covers behaviour at initial buckling@ immediately after buckling and at failure in local or overall modes. A plate is defined as a portion of sheet bounded by longitudinal and transverse members or a portion of sheet bounded by two or three such members and having the remaining one or two sides free. A panel is defined as a sheet bounded transversely by sturdy frames between which the sheet is stiffened by longitudinal members (stringers). For a panel the major compressive stress is taken to be acting parallel to the stringers. The stringers and frames may be integrally manufactured with the sheet or separately attached.
